When winter returns to the lower Merrimack Valley, so do Bald Eagles and Snowy Owls and other exciting winter wildlife. Every year we host a grand event marking their return.
This year, we hope you'll join us online and in-person for programs in the Newburyport area to celebrate our very special winter residents! The 18th Annual Merrimack River Eagle Festival events will be held Tuesday, February 14 – Saturday, February 18, 2023.
